/device/linaro/bootloader/edk2/SourceLevelDebugPkg/Library/PeCoffExtraActionLibDebug/X64/ |
D | IntHandlerFuncs.c | 34 UINTN InterruptHandler; in CheckDebugAgentHandler() local 41 InterruptHandler = IdtEntry[InterruptType].Bits.OffsetLow + in CheckDebugAgentHandler() 44 …if (InterruptHandler >= sizeof (UINT32) && *(UINT32 *)(InterruptHandler - sizeof (UINT32)) == AGE… in CheckDebugAgentHandler() 66 UINTN InterruptHandler; in SaveAndUpdateIdtEntry1() local 76 InterruptHandler = (UINTN) &AsmInterruptHandle; in SaveAndUpdateIdtEntry1() 77 IdtEntry[1].Bits.OffsetLow = (UINT16)(UINTN)InterruptHandler; in SaveAndUpdateIdtEntry1() 78 IdtEntry[1].Bits.OffsetHigh = (UINT16)((UINTN)InterruptHandler >> 16); in SaveAndUpdateIdtEntry1() 79 IdtEntry[1].Bits.OffsetUpper = (UINT32)((UINTN)InterruptHandler >> 32); in SaveAndUpdateIdtEntry1()
|
/device/linaro/bootloader/edk2/SourceLevelDebugPkg/Library/PeCoffExtraActionLibDebug/Ia32/ |
D | IntHandlerFuncs.c | 34 UINTN InterruptHandler; in CheckDebugAgentHandler() local 41 InterruptHandler = IdtEntry[InterruptType].Bits.OffsetLow + in CheckDebugAgentHandler() 43 …if (InterruptHandler >= sizeof (UINT32) && *(UINT32 *)(InterruptHandler - sizeof (UINT32)) == AGE… in CheckDebugAgentHandler() 65 UINTN InterruptHandler; in SaveAndUpdateIdtEntry1() local 75 InterruptHandler = (UINTN) &AsmInterruptHandle; in SaveAndUpdateIdtEntry1() 76 IdtEntry[1].Bits.OffsetLow = (UINT16)(UINTN)InterruptHandler; in SaveAndUpdateIdtEntry1() 77 IdtEntry[1].Bits.OffsetHigh = (UINT16)((UINTN)InterruptHandler >> 16); in SaveAndUpdateIdtEntry1()
|
/device/linaro/bootloader/edk2/SourceLevelDebugPkg/Library/DebugAgent/DebugAgentCommon/X64/ |
D | ArchDebugSupport.c | 27 UINTN InterruptHandler; in InitializeDebugIdt() local 49 InterruptHandler = (UINTN)&Exception0Handle + Index * ExceptionStubHeaderSize; in InitializeDebugIdt() 50 IdtEntry[Index].Bits.OffsetLow = (UINT16)(UINTN)InterruptHandler; in InitializeDebugIdt() 51 IdtEntry[Index].Bits.OffsetHigh = (UINT16)((UINTN)InterruptHandler >> 16); in InitializeDebugIdt() 52 IdtEntry[Index].Bits.OffsetUpper = (UINT32)((UINTN)InterruptHandler >> 32); in InitializeDebugIdt() 57 InterruptHandler = (UINTN) &TimerInterruptHandle; in InitializeDebugIdt() 58 IdtEntry[DEBUG_TIMER_VECTOR].Bits.OffsetLow = (UINT16)(UINTN)InterruptHandler; in InitializeDebugIdt() 59 IdtEntry[DEBUG_TIMER_VECTOR].Bits.OffsetHigh = (UINT16)((UINTN)InterruptHandler >> 16); in InitializeDebugIdt() 60 IdtEntry[DEBUG_TIMER_VECTOR].Bits.OffsetUpper = (UINT32)((UINTN)InterruptHandler >> 32); in InitializeDebugIdt()
|
/device/linaro/bootloader/edk2/SourceLevelDebugPkg/Library/DebugAgent/DebugAgentCommon/Ia32/ |
D | ArchDebugSupport.c | 27 UINTN InterruptHandler; in InitializeDebugIdt() local 49 InterruptHandler = (UINTN)&Exception0Handle + Index * ExceptionStubHeaderSize; in InitializeDebugIdt() 50 IdtEntry[Index].Bits.OffsetLow = (UINT16)(UINTN)InterruptHandler; in InitializeDebugIdt() 51 IdtEntry[Index].Bits.OffsetHigh = (UINT16)((UINTN)InterruptHandler >> 16); in InitializeDebugIdt() 56 InterruptHandler = (UINTN) &TimerInterruptHandle; in InitializeDebugIdt() 57 IdtEntry[DEBUG_TIMER_VECTOR].Bits.OffsetLow = (UINT16)(UINTN)InterruptHandler; in InitializeDebugIdt() 58 IdtEntry[DEBUG_TIMER_VECTOR].Bits.OffsetHigh = (UINT16)((UINTN)InterruptHandler >> 16); in InitializeDebugIdt()
|
/device/linaro/bootloader/edk2/UefiCpuPkg/Library/CpuExceptionHandlerLib/ |
D | PeiDxeSmmCpuException.c | 136 UINTN InterruptHandler; in UpdateIdtTable() local 183 InterruptHandler = TemplateMap->ExceptionStart + Index * TemplateMap->ExceptionStubHeaderSize; in UpdateIdtTable() 184 ArchUpdateIdtEntry (&IdtTable[Index], InterruptHandler); in UpdateIdtTable() 266 IN EFI_CPU_INTERRUPT_HANDLER InterruptHandler, in RegisterCpuInterruptHandlerWorker() argument 283 if (InterruptHandler == NULL && ExternalInterruptHandler[InterruptType] == NULL) { in RegisterCpuInterruptHandlerWorker() 287 if (InterruptHandler != NULL && ExternalInterruptHandler[InterruptType] != NULL) { in RegisterCpuInterruptHandlerWorker() 291 ExternalInterruptHandler[InterruptType] = InterruptHandler; in RegisterCpuInterruptHandlerWorker()
|
D | SecPeiCpuException.c | 80 UINTN InterruptHandler; in InitializeCpuExceptionHandlers() local 121 InterruptHandler = TemplateMap.ExceptionStart + Index * TemplateMap.ExceptionStubHeaderSize; in InitializeCpuExceptionHandlers() 122 ArchUpdateIdtEntry (&IdtTable[Index], InterruptHandler); in InitializeCpuExceptionHandlers() 179 IN EFI_CPU_INTERRUPT_HANDLER InterruptHandler in RegisterCpuInterruptHandler() argument
|
D | SmmException.c | 129 IN EFI_CPU_INTERRUPT_HANDLER InterruptHandler in RegisterCpuInterruptHandler() argument 132 …return RegisterCpuInterruptHandlerWorker (InterruptType, InterruptHandler, &mExceptionHandlerData); in RegisterCpuInterruptHandler()
|
D | CpuExceptionCommon.h | 82 IN UINTN InterruptHandler 176 IN EFI_CPU_INTERRUPT_HANDLER InterruptHandler,
|
D | DxeException.c | 200 IN EFI_CPU_INTERRUPT_HANDLER InterruptHandler in RegisterCpuInterruptHandler() argument 203 …return RegisterCpuInterruptHandlerWorker (InterruptType, InterruptHandler, &mExceptionHandlerData); in RegisterCpuInterruptHandler()
|
/device/linaro/bootloader/edk2/ArmPkg/Drivers/ArmGic/GicV2/ |
D | ArmGicV2Dxe.c | 165 HARDWARE_INTERRUPT_HANDLER InterruptHandler; in GicV2IrqInterruptHandler() local 175 InterruptHandler = gRegisteredInterruptHandlers[GicInterrupt]; in GicV2IrqInterruptHandler() 176 if (InterruptHandler != NULL) { in GicV2IrqInterruptHandler() 178 InterruptHandler (GicInterrupt, SystemContext); in GicV2IrqInterruptHandler()
|
/device/linaro/bootloader/edk2/ArmPkg/Drivers/ArmGic/GicV3/ |
D | ArmGicV3Dxe.c | 155 HARDWARE_INTERRUPT_HANDLER InterruptHandler; in GicV3IrqInterruptHandler() local 166 InterruptHandler = gRegisteredInterruptHandlers[GicInterrupt]; in GicV3IrqInterruptHandler() 167 if (InterruptHandler != NULL) { in GicV3IrqInterruptHandler() 169 InterruptHandler (GicInterrupt, SystemContext); in GicV3IrqInterruptHandler()
|
/device/linaro/bootloader/edk2/ArmPkg/Drivers/CpuDxe/ |
D | Exception.c | 100 IN EFI_CPU_INTERRUPT_HANDLER InterruptHandler in RegisterInterruptHandler() argument 103 return (EFI_STATUS)RegisterCpuInterruptHandler(InterruptType, InterruptHandler); in RegisterInterruptHandler()
|
D | CpuDxe.h | 73 IN EFI_CPU_INTERRUPT_HANDLER InterruptHandler 100 IN EFI_CPU_INTERRUPT_HANDLER InterruptHandler
|
D | CpuDxe.c | 178 IN EFI_CPU_INTERRUPT_HANDLER InterruptHandler in CpuRegisterInterruptHandler() argument 181 return RegisterInterruptHandler (InterruptType, InterruptHandler); in CpuRegisterInterruptHandler()
|
/device/linaro/bootloader/edk2/Omap35xxPkg/InterruptDxe/ |
D | HardwareInterrupt.c | 264 HARDWARE_INTERRUPT_HANDLER InterruptHandler; in IrqInterruptHandler() local 272 InterruptHandler = gRegisteredInterruptHandlers[Vector]; in IrqInterruptHandler() 273 if (InterruptHandler != NULL) { in IrqInterruptHandler() 275 InterruptHandler (Vector, SystemContext); in IrqInterruptHandler()
|
/device/linaro/bootloader/edk2/ArmPkg/Library/ArmExceptionLib/ |
D | ArmExceptionLib.c | 39 IN EFI_CPU_INTERRUPT_HANDLER InterruptHandler 297 IN EFI_CPU_INTERRUPT_HANDLER InterruptHandler in RegisterExceptionHandler() argument 300 return RegisterCpuInterruptHandler(ExceptionType, InterruptHandler); in RegisterExceptionHandler()
|
/device/linaro/bootloader/edk2/UefiCpuPkg/Library/CpuExceptionHandlerLib/X64/ |
D | ArchExceptionHandler.c | 27 IN UINTN InterruptHandler in ArchUpdateIdtEntry() argument 30 IdtEntry->Bits.OffsetLow = (UINT16)(UINTN)InterruptHandler; in ArchUpdateIdtEntry() 31 IdtEntry->Bits.OffsetHigh = (UINT16)((UINTN)InterruptHandler >> 16); in ArchUpdateIdtEntry() 32 IdtEntry->Bits.OffsetUpper = (UINT32)((UINTN)InterruptHandler >> 32); in ArchUpdateIdtEntry()
|
/device/linaro/bootloader/edk2/ArmPkg/Drivers/ArmGic/ |
D | ArmGicCommonDxe.c | 91 IN EFI_CPU_INTERRUPT_HANDLER InterruptHandler, in InstallAndRegisterInterruptService() argument 132 Status = Cpu->RegisterInterruptHandler (Cpu, ARM_ARCH_EXCEPTION_IRQ, InterruptHandler); in InstallAndRegisterInterruptService()
|
D | ArmGicDxe.h | 37 IN EFI_CPU_INTERRUPT_HANDLER InterruptHandler,
|
/device/linaro/bootloader/edk2/UefiCpuPkg/Library/CpuExceptionHandlerLib/Ia32/ |
D | ArchExceptionHandler.c | 28 IN UINTN InterruptHandler in ArchUpdateIdtEntry() argument 31 IdtEntry->Bits.OffsetLow = (UINT16)(UINTN)InterruptHandler; in ArchUpdateIdtEntry() 32 IdtEntry->Bits.OffsetHigh = (UINT16)((UINTN)InterruptHandler >> 16); in ArchUpdateIdtEntry()
|
/device/linaro/bootloader/edk2/MdeModulePkg/Include/Library/ |
D | CpuExceptionHandlerLib.h | 93 IN EFI_CPU_INTERRUPT_HANDLER InterruptHandler
|
/device/linaro/bootloader/edk2/MdeModulePkg/Library/CpuExceptionHandlerLibNull/ |
D | CpuExceptionHandlerLibNull.c | 94 IN EFI_CPU_INTERRUPT_HANDLER InterruptHandler in RegisterCpuInterruptHandler() argument
|
/device/linaro/bootloader/edk2/UefiCpuPkg/PiSmmCpuDxeSmm/ |
D | CpuService.h | 150 IN EFI_CPU_INTERRUPT_HANDLER InterruptHandler
|
D | CpuService.c | 341 IN EFI_CPU_INTERRUPT_HANDLER InterruptHandler in SmmRegisterExceptionHandler() argument 344 return RegisterCpuInterruptHandler (ExceptionType, InterruptHandler); in SmmRegisterExceptionHandler()
|
/device/linaro/bootloader/edk2/UefiCpuPkg/Include/Protocol/ |
D | SmmCpuService.h | 192 IN EFI_CPU_INTERRUPT_HANDLER InterruptHandler
|